Baines vs WBA

Leighton Baines has asked Everton to allow him to move to Manchester United according to reports in tomorrow’s papers.

The left back has been heavily linked with a move to Manchester United  this summer but has remained silent amidst speculation, instead concentrating on his football.

Last week United’s interest was confirmed when Everton publicly admonished a £28m joint bid for Baines and team mate Marouane Fellaini, claiming that it was ‘derisory’.

According to The Independent, Baines made it clear earlier in the summer that he would like to join United and with the transfer window closing has continued to make it clear that he would like his club to reach an agreement with the champions.

Everton have thus far ignores Baines’ plea but with United set to make what will be a fourth bid for the 28 year old, may now finally play ball and negotiate.
